About the team You'll join a collaborative, forward-thinking team responsible for delivering and supporting Hedge Fund Portfolio Management (VPM) solutions to financial services clients. Our group combines deep technical expertise with a strong understanding of business processes, ensuring seamless deployments and upgrades of complex enterprise software in regulated environments. Collaboration, technical rigor, and client partnership are at the core of our approach. What you will be doing As a Technical Business Consultant, you will be the bridge between client business needs and technical implementation for VPM solutions. You will: * Lead and coordinate VPM installation, upgrade, and deployment projects for clients, ensuring all technical and business requirements are met. * Validate and document pre-requisites, server configurations, and connectivity for new and existing environments. * Guide clients through pre-deployment, deployment, and post-deployment activities, including troubleshooting and knowledge transfer. * Liaise with client IT, business stakeholders, and internal teams to resolve issues and implement corrective actions. * Ensure compliance with security, licensing, and operational standards throughout the project lifecycle. Additional Duties and Responsibility * Assess and document client infrastructure, connectivity, and security requirements for VPM deployments (including VPN, portals, and server access). * Oversee server and application pre-requirements discovery (Windows Server, SQL Server, IIS, network ports, certificates, etc.). * Manage deployment checklists, including software installation (MSI packages), configuration of software files, and license management. * Coordinate with DBA and IT teams for SQL Server setup, reporting services, and backup/restore operations. * Provide post-deployment support, including functional testing, troubleshooting, and documentation handover. * Ensure all service accounts, permissions, and security policies are correctly configured and documented. * Support the creation and management of VPM Share folders, service accounts, and client workspaces. * Maintain compliance with password, certificate, and security best practices. What you Bring * Strong technical background in enterprise software deployment, preferably in financial services or regulated industries. * Experience with Windows Server administration, SQL Server, IIS, and network security. * Ability to interpret and execute detailed technical checklists and deployment guides. * Excellent communication skills for client-facing roles, including documentation and training. * Analytical and problem-solving mindset, with attention to detail and process compliance. * Familiarity with certificate management, Active Directory, and service account permissions. Additional Required Technical Knowledge * Server & Application Setup: Windows Server, SQL Server, IIS, .NET Framework, ODBC drivers, certificate management, network/firewall configuration. * Process & Documentation: Pre-requisite validation, deployment checklists, EP.XML configuration, backup/restore, license management, and post-deployment verification. * Collaboration: Working with client IT, DBA, and business teams; managing permissions, security policies, and troubleshooting. * Tools: SSMS, appwiz.cpl, lusrmgr.msc, secpol.msc, and various MSI installers for VPM components. * Best Practices: Security compliance, documentation, and adherence to process for regulated environments. * Troubleshooting: Diagnosing and resolving issues with VPM components, Smart Client, Excel Add-In, and reporting packages.
